Institutional Momentum Grows as Aviva Partners with Ripple to Run Funds on XRPL

13.02.2026 - 04:20:23

Ripple is accelerating its integration with conventional finance by teaming up with Aviva Investors to migrate traditional fund structures onto the XRP Ledger. The collaboration signals a broader push toward tokenizing real-world assets and could bolster institutional demand for XRP over the longer term.

A Link Between TradFi and the Blockchain

The centerpiece of the agreement is using the XRP Ledger (XRPL) to administer traditional investment funds. Aviva Investors intends to deploy blockchain technology to streamline the issuance and management of fund shares. The firm highlights several benefits, including faster transaction processing, lower costs, and the network?s energy efficiency. For Ripple, this marks the first collaboration of its kind with a European asset manager, reinforcing the company?s focus on institutional clients.

Surge in On-Chain Activity

The news comes amid a clear uptick in XRPL activity. On-chain analytics show the number of active addresses on the XRPL nearly doubled from Sunday to Wednesday, now exceeding 32,700.

Separately, Bybit announced a partnership with Doppler Finance to introduce institutional yield products tied to XRP. Since XRP does not support native staking, this collaboration addresses a key gap for large investors seeking ongoing returns.

Big-Player Interest Takes Shape

Institutional interest appears to be broadening, as large transfers?over $100,000?hit a four-month high. Among notable movements were shifts totaling 125 million XRP. In price terms, XRP advanced roughly 11% over the past week, landing near $1.36, though the cryptocurrency remains noticeably lower on a year-to-date basis.

Leadership View and Strategic Direction

CEO Brad Garlinghouse has reiterated XRP?s role as a guiding element in the company?s strategy, describing it as the ?north star.? He also signaled possible acquisitions in the second half of 2026. Coupled with ongoing regulatory discussions in Washington, the comments suggest Ripple is sharpening its emphasis on tangible real-world applications and sustained institutional growth.
